Inter Milan veterans Alexis Sanchez and Marko Arnautovic are vying for a starting berth in Sunday night’s encounter against Cagliari.

The Nerazzurri are on the cusp of clinching their 20th league title. They’ll be looking to make the Isolani their latest victims on the road towards an imminent triumph.

However, Simone Inzaghi will be missing the services of Benjamin Pavard and Lautaro Martinez. Both players picked their fifth booking of the campaign in Monday’s dramatic win over Udinese.

So according to Sky Sport Italia via FcInterNews, Sanchez and Arnautovic are competing for a spot up front alongside Marcus Thuram.

The source believes that the odds are almost similar, with the Chilean emerging as the favorite, but by the slightest of margins (51%).

The report expects Inzaghi to render his final decision tomorrow, on the eve of the match.

On the other hand, Yann Bisseck has emerged as the ultimate candidate to replace Pavard at the back.

The German has been acting as the understudy of the 2018 World Cup winner since the start of the season. Therefore, he’ll be the natural candidate to replace the Frenchman while the latter serves a one-match ban.

On another note, Sky (via FcInterNews) reveals that Inzaghi finally had a full squad at his disposal in Friday’s training session.

Earlier this week, Alessandro Bastoni and Juan Cuadrado resumed training with their teammates.

Stefan de Vrij was the last missing member of the squad, as he was undergoing a personalized training regime.

Nevertheless, the Dutchman has overcome his physical problem and rejoined group training to complete the ranks.
